While I was checking out those Rachelle Plas videos, I found that Turtle Walk video (in the same thread). That got me wondering, "who's Greg Zlap?" Well that question plus google brought me across this site Harmopoint.com

This site employs a pretty cool way to teach exercises and songs by having a little harmonica and the holes light up a certain way depending on if it's a blow, draw, or bend. It doesn't teach how to do the techniques but it does offer quite a few play along exercises. In the workshop section there are a few different artists teaching riffs and turnarounds and stuff like that. Their youtube videos are pretty cool too.

I thought it was pretty cool because I'm always looking for short exercises and.... it's free.

It's a neat site. I think GH may have posted it a while back. Another good related site is the Bendometer. There is a free trial but after that you have to pay. It combines something like harmopoint thing with a tuner so it will tell you what notes you are playing, including showing you how accurate your bends are.
